位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el问答 > 文章详情

为什么excel处理特别慢

作者:excel百科网
|
261人看过
发布时间:2026-01-03 09:50:31
标签:
为什么Excel处理特别慢?在当今数据驱动的时代,Excel作为一款广泛使用的电子表格软件,其性能表现直接影响到工作效率。然而,对于某些用户而言,Excel在处理大量数据时却显得“吃力”,甚至“卡顿”。本文将深入分析Excel处理缓慢
为什么excel处理特别慢
为什么Excel处理特别慢?
在当今数据驱动的时代,Excel作为一款广泛使用的电子表格软件,其性能表现直接影响到工作效率。然而,对于某些用户而言,Excel在处理大量数据时却显得“吃力”,甚至“卡顿”。本文将深入分析Excel处理缓慢的潜在原因,并结合官方资料,提供实用的优化建议。
一、Excel处理缓慢的常见原因
1. 数据量过大导致内存不足
Excel在处理大量数据时,尤其是超大规模的数据集,会占用大量的内存资源。当数据量超过Excel可有效管理的范围时,系统会自动将部分数据加载到内存中,导致处理速度变慢。根据微软官方资料,Excel支持的最大数据量约为100万行,超过这一数量后,性能会显著下降。
2. 复杂的公式和函数
Excel中的公式和函数是数据处理的核心,但其复杂度直接影响计算速度。例如,嵌套函数、数组公式、VBA宏等都会增加计算负担。微软指出,复杂公式会显著降低Excel的处理效率,尤其是在处理大量数据时,计算时间会大幅增加。
3. 图表和数据可视化
图表是Excel中常见的数据呈现方式,但图表的复杂程度和数据量也会影响性能。如果图表包含大量数据,或使用了复杂的图表类型(如瀑布图、热力图等),Excel会额外增加计算量,导致处理速度变慢。
4. 文件格式和存储方式
Excel文件的格式(如.xlsx或.xls)以及存储方式(如本地文件或云存储)也会影响性能。如果文件过大,或存储在慢速硬盘上,Excel的读取和处理速度会受到影响。
二、优化Excel性能的实用方法
1. 优化数据结构和公式
- 减少公式嵌套:避免过度嵌套的公式,适当拆分公式,提升计算效率。
- 使用辅助列:将复杂计算移到辅助列中,减少主表格的计算负担。
- 使用数组公式:适当使用数组公式,可以提高数据处理效率,但需要注意计算量。
2. 优化图表和数据可视化
- 简化图表类型:使用基础图表类型(如柱状图、折线图)替代复杂图表。
- 减少数据点:在图表中只展示必要的数据点,避免过多数据干扰计算。
- 使用动态数据区域:将图表的数据区域设置为动态范围,Excel会自动更新数据,减少重复计算。
3. 优化文件存储和格式
- 压缩文件:使用Excel的“压缩文件”功能,减少文件大小,提升加载速度。
- 使用云存储:将文件存储在云端(如OneDrive、Google Drive),减少本地文件的负担。
4. 使用Excel的性能优化功能
- 启用“Excel性能优化”:在Excel选项中启用“性能选项”,可以减少自动计算和公式计算的频率。
- 使用“快速计算”功能:在“公式选项”中启用“快速计算”,可以加快计算速度。
三、优化策略的实践应用
1. 从源头控制数据量
在Excel中,可以使用“数据”菜单中的“数据验证”功能,限制输入数据的范围,避免数据量过大。此外,使用“筛选”功能,可以快速定位和处理数据,减少不必要的计算。
2. 使用VBA进行自动化处理
如果Excel中存在大量重复性操作,可以使用VBA编写脚本,实现自动化处理。例如,使用VBA自动填充、自动计算、自动导出数据等功能,可以显著提升处理效率。
3. 利用Excel的“数据透视表”功能
数据透视表是Excel中处理大量数据的利器。它能够快速汇总和分析数据,减少手动操作。使用数据透视表可以大幅提高处理速度,尤其适合处理复杂的数据集。
4. 优化文件格式和存储方式
- 使用.xlsx格式:相比于.xls格式,.xlsx文件在存储和处理上更为高效。
- 使用高速存储设备:将Excel文件存储在SSD或高速硬盘上,可以显著提升文件的加载和处理速度。
四、性能优化的常见误区
1. 误以为公式越复杂越好
公式是数据处理的核心,但过于复杂的公式会显著降低Excel的性能。因此,应避免过度使用复杂公式,而是采用更高效的方法进行数据处理。
2. 误以为图表越复杂越好
图表是数据可视化的重要工具,但过于复杂的图表会增加Excel的计算负担。应根据实际需求选择图表类型,避免不必要的复杂度。
3. 误以为文件越大越好
文件大小并不一定意味着性能越好。文件越小,处理速度越快,但数据量大时,Excel的计算能力仍会受到影响。
五、总结
Excel作为一款广泛使用的电子表格软件,其性能表现直接影响工作效率。处理缓慢的原因多样,包括数据量过大、公式复杂、图表复杂、文件格式不当等。通过优化数据结构、公式使用、图表设计、文件存储等方式,可以显著提升Excel的处理效率。同时,需要注意避免常见的误区,合理使用Excel的功能,提高数据处理的效率和准确性。
在实际工作中,应根据具体需求,灵活运用Excel的性能优化策略,以达到最佳的处理效果。只有不断优化和改进,才能在数据处理中实现高效、稳定、准确的成果。
推荐文章
相关文章
推荐URL
财务报表Excel用到什么在当今的商业环境中,财务报表是企业经营状况的重要体现,也是决策者了解企业运营情况的关键工具。Excel作为一款功能强大的电子表格软件,已经成为企业财务分析和报表制作的首选工具。对于财务报表的制作与分析,Exc
2026-01-03 09:42:48
140人看过
Excel求和函数的详细解析与应用指南在Excel中,求和是一项基础而重要的操作,无论是日常的数据处理,还是复杂的财务分析,求和函数都是不可或缺的工具。Excel提供了多种求和函数,每种函数都有其适用场景和使用方式。本文将详细解析Ex
2026-01-03 09:42:32
72人看过
Excel时间求差公式详解:从基础到高级在Excel中,时间计算是一个非常实用的功能,尤其在处理日期和时间数据时,它能帮助用户高效地完成各种时间差的计算。时间差通常指的是两个时间点之间的间隔,例如从2023年5月1日到2023年5月2
2026-01-03 09:41:33
371人看过
Excel中字体中都有什么:深入解析Excel字体的种类与使用技巧Excel是一款广泛应用于数据处理、报表制作和数据分析的办公软件。在Excel中,字体的选择不仅影响文档的美观程度,还会影响数据的可读性与专业性。本文将深入探讨Exce
2026-01-03 09:41:25
252人看过
热门推荐
热门专题:
资讯中心: